About the Item
George Lawley 260 Class blueprint. Rich blue plan showing mast and sail dimensions. This is a double ended design by C. Raymond Hunt. This plan is for a thirty one foot yacht and was drawn by Wilder B. Harris. The legend plate reads: "260 Class", George Lawley & Son, Boston, Massachusetts. March 7, 1940, scale 1/2 inch to a foot. The "260" was a thirty foot variation of the "225" and "110". Nicely framed.
